Some "Georgia Peaches" make their mark in unexpected ways. Take the "Peach Lady," Nannie Celia "Pete" Abercrombie Haygood, who lived to be 102. For nearly 50 years, she became a local legend by operating a peach stand at a rural intersection, becoming a fixture of the landscape and its hospitality. Her story shows that a Granny's influence can be measured not just by her family but by her years of service to her community, one peach at a time.
